Fundamentals of Data Analysis

Data analysis is the process of collecting, processing, and analysing data to extract valuable information. This process is crucial for deriving targeted insights from large datasets, often referred to as Big Data. Big Data is characterised by its volume, complexity, and velocity, making it difficult to filter out relevant information without appropriate analytical techniques [1][8].

From Big Data to Smart Data

Smart Data is the evolution of Big Data. It refers to high-quality, specifically selected information extracted from large datasets. This data is processed to deliver directly usable knowledge that supports businesses in strategic decision-making [3][4]. An example of this is the use of sensors in industry, which enable predictive maintenance through the analysis of machine data, thereby minimising downtime [2][7].

Data Analysis in Practice

Data analysis is used in many industries to optimise business processes. In the financial sector, for example, data-intelligent analyses help to base portfolio decisions on reliable data, rather than relying on unstructured masses of information [4]. In logistics, the targeted filtering of big data makes it possible to make supply chains more transparent and to identify bottlenecks at an early stage [4].
